Elder Nutrition Activity Coordinator

Cherokee NationTahlequah, OK
Onsite

About The Position

The Elder Nutrition Activity Coordinator is responsible for planning, organizing, and implementing a wide range of recreational, educational, cultural, and social activities that support the wellbeing of elders. This role ensures programs are engaging, culturally appropriate, and aligned with the physical, emotional, and social needs of participants. The coordinator maintains activity schedules, oversees program logistics, collaborates with staff and community partners, and helps foster a safe, welcoming, and inclusive environment. The position also tracks participation, assists with special events, and supports the overall mission of enhancing quality of life for elders through meaningful daily engagement.

Requirements

  • Bachelor’s degree in human services, social work, recreation, family consumer sciences, related field or an equivalent combination of education and experience in lieu of degree.
  • Two (2) years of experience in a related field.
  • Proficient in Microsoft Office Suite
  • Excellent verbal and written communication
  • Ability to build strong working relationships with a diverse population
  • Analytical mindset and problem-solving skills
  • Ability to lead, coach, and mentor others
  • Customer service focus
  • Meticulous attention to detail and strong organizational skills
  • Ability to hold strict confidentiality
  • Must possess a valid driver's license with a driving history verified through a motor vehicle report that meets the requirements for Cherokee Nation underwriting rating.
  • Possess or ability to obtain CPR, first aid certification, and food handler’s card within three (3) months and maintain throughout employment.
  • The employee must not be and will not be under sanction by the United States Department of Health and Human Services Office of the Inspector General (OIG) or by the General Services Administration (GSA) or listed on the OIG's Cumulative Sanction Report, or the GSA's List of Excluded Providers, or listed on the OIG's List of Excluded Individuals/Entities (LEIE).
